If you get admitted to Harvard, financial aid will not likely be a problem. Harvard, as well as many of the Ivys have undertaken a financial aid intiative in which all admitted students, whose parents earn incomes under $60000 will recieve financial compensation generous enough that their parents don't have to pay a cent, or they have to pay very, very little.
I would suggest checking with the school as well as making sure that you fill out the financial aid application (due in Jan/Feb) which is separate from the actual application for admissions. You should recieve information regarding financial aid during or after you application process, but if not, it is simple to find out more on their website.
